#include <stdio.h>
|
||
|
#include <stdlib.h>
|
||
|
#include <stdbool.h>
|
||
|
#include <math.h>
|
||
|
#include <unistd.h>
|
||
|
#include <assert.h>
|
||
|
|
||
|
#include <GLES3/gl3.h>
|
||
|
#include <EGL/egl.h>
|
||
|
#include <EGL/eglext.h>
|
||
|
|
||
|
#include "nanovg.h"
|
||
|
#define NANOVG_GLES3_IMPLEMENTATION
|
||
|
#include "nanovg_gl.h"
|
||
|
#include "nanovg_gl_utils.h"
|
||
|
|
||
|
#include "framebuffer.h"
|
||
|
#include "spinner.h"
|
||
|
|
||
|
// external resources linked in
|
||
|
extern const unsigned char _binary_opensans_semibold_ttf_start[];
|
||
|
extern const unsigned char _binary_opensans_semibold_ttf_end[];
|
||
|
|
||
|
extern const unsigned char _binary_img_spinner_track_png_start[];
|
||
|
extern const unsigned char _binary_img_spinner_track_png_end[];
|
||
|
|
||
|
extern const unsigned char _binary_img_spinner_comma_png_start[];
|
||
|
extern const unsigned char _binary_img_spinner_comma_png_end[];
|
||
|
|
||
|
int spin(int argc, char** argv) {
|
||
|
int err;
|
||
|
|
||
|
const char* spintext = NULL;
|
||
|
if (argc == 1) {
|
||
|
spintext = argv[0];
|
||
|
} else if (argc >= 2) {
|
||
|
spintext = argv[1];
|
||
|
}
|
||
|
|
||
|
// spinner
|
||
|
int fb_w, fb_h;
|
||
|
EGLDisplay display;
|
||
|
EGLSurface surface;
|
||
|
FramebufferState *fb = framebuffer_init("spinner", 0x00001000, false,
|
||
|
&display, &surface, &fb_w, &fb_h);
|
||
|
assert(fb);
|
||
|
|
||
|
NVGcontext *vg = nvgCreateGLES3(NVG_ANTIALIAS | NVG_STENCIL_STROKES);
|
||
|
assert(vg);
|
||
|
|
||
|
int font = nvgCreateFontMem(vg, "Bold", (unsigned char*)_binary_opensans_semibold_ttf_start, _binary_opensans_semibold_ttf_end-_binary_opensans_semibold_ttf_start, 0);
|
||
|
assert(font >= 0);
|
||
|
|
||
|
int spinner_img = nvgCreateImageMem(vg, 0, (unsigned char*)_binary_img_spinner_track_png_start, _binary_img_spinner_track_png_end - _binary_img_spinner_track_png_start);
|
||
|
assert(spinner_img >= 0);
|
||
|
int spinner_img_s = 360;
|
||
|
int spinner_img_x = ((fb_w/2)-(spinner_img_s/2));
|
||
|
int spinner_img_y = 260;
|
||
|
int spinner_img_xc = (fb_w/2);
|
||
|
int spinner_img_yc = (fb_h/2)-100;
|
||
|
int spinner_comma_img = nvgCreateImageMem(vg, 0, (unsigned char*)_binary_img_spinner_comma_png_start, _binary_img_spinner_comma_png_end - _binary_img_spinner_comma_png_start);
|
||
|
assert(spinner_comma_img >= 0);
|
||
|
|
||
|
for (int cnt = 0; ; cnt++) {
|
||
|
glClearColor(0.1, 0.1, 0.1, 1.0);
|
||
|
glClear(GL_STENCIL_BUFFER_BIT | GL_COLOR_BUFFER_BIT);
|
||
|
glEnable(GL_BLEND);
|
||
|
glBlendFunc(GL_SRC_ALPHA, GL_ONE_MINUS_SRC_ALPHA);
|
||
|
nvgBeginFrame(vg, fb_w, fb_h, 1.0f);
|
||
|
|
||
|
// background
|
||
|
nvgBeginPath(vg);
|
||
|
NVGpaint bg = nvgLinearGradient(vg, fb_w, 0, fb_w, fb_h,
|
||
|
nvgRGBA(0, 0, 0, 175), nvgRGBA(0, 0, 0, 255));
|
||
|
nvgFillPaint(vg, bg);
|
||
|
nvgRect(vg, 0, 0, fb_w, fb_h);
|
||
|
nvgFill(vg);
|
||
|
|
||
|
// spin track
|
||
|
nvgSave(vg);
|
||
|
nvgTranslate(vg, spinner_img_xc, spinner_img_yc);
|
||
|
nvgRotate(vg, (3.75*M_PI * cnt/120.0));
|
||
|
nvgTranslate(vg, -spinner_img_xc, -spinner_img_yc);
|
||
|
NVGpaint spinner_imgPaint = nvgImagePattern(vg, spinner_img_x, spinner_img_y,
|
||
|
spinner_img_s, spinner_img_s, 0, spinner_img, 0.6f);
|
||
|
nvgBeginPath(vg);
|
||
|
nvgFillPaint(vg, spinner_imgPaint);
|
||
|
nvgRect(vg, spinner_img_x, spinner_img_y, spinner_img_s, spinner_img_s);
|
||
|
nvgFill(vg);
|
||
|
nvgRestore(vg);
|
||
|
|
||
|
// comma
|
||
|
NVGpaint comma_imgPaint = nvgImagePattern(vg, spinner_img_x, spinner_img_y,
|
||
|
spinner_img_s, spinner_img_s, 0, spinner_comma_img, 1.0f);
|
||
|
nvgBeginPath(vg);
|
||
|
nvgFillPaint(vg, comma_imgPaint);
|
||
|
nvgRect(vg, spinner_img_x, spinner_img_y, spinner_img_s, spinner_img_s);
|
||
|
nvgFill(vg);
|
||
|
|
||
|
// message
|
||
|
if (spintext) {
|
||
|
nvgTextAlign(vg, NVG_ALIGN_CENTER | NVG_ALIGN_TOP);
|
||
|
nvgFontSize(vg, 96.0f);
|
||
|
nvgText(vg, fb_w/2, (fb_h*2/3)+24, spintext, NULL);
|
||
|
}
|
||
|
|
||
|
nvgEndFrame(vg);
|
||
|
eglSwapBuffers(display, surface);
|
||
|
assert(glGetError() == GL_NO_ERROR);
|
||
|
}
|
||
|
|
||
|
return 0;
|
||
|
}
